According to the case study of Sally in which she is suffering from a multi sclerosisdiseases in which she was facing problem of tingling and numbness in her left foot earlier andthen issues are continuously increasing according to time such as double vision, weakness to do1
Supporting Independent Living Assignment Solution_3

daily routine work and several changes in her memory function. Due to this, she is unable to livean independent life and become needy for someone to conduct regular routine work such astyping, holding lunch tray, problem in mobility due to which she was referred to an occupationtherapists for Ankle Foot Orthosis (AFO). At last, a psychologist conduct a effective analysis ofstrengths and weakness of Sally to determine actual problem and prescribe to use a hand heldpersonal digital assistant (PDA) which is commonly known as pocket coach to aid memoryskills. Overall, this digital tool make Sally independent from others to live her life properly(Blackman and et. al., 2016). 1.2 Barriers to use of technology in health and social careTechnology is useful in different types of aspects and help to achieve better outcomesbut several barriers are also there that interrupts in using theses techniques in health and socialcare.
